Tīmeklis2024. gada 8. okt. · This is the documentation for Espressif IoT Development Framework (ESP-IDF). ESP-IDF is the official development framework for Espressif chips such as ESP32, ESP32-S2, ESP32-S3, ESP32-C2, and ESP32-C3.
